spec/run_spec.rb in yacli-0.1.8 vs spec/run_spec.rb in yacli-0.2.0
- old
+ new
@@ -3,38 +3,25 @@
include Helpers
describe Yacli::Run do
context 'run is successfull' do
- let(:opt) {
+ let(:opt) do
{
- 'cmd' => 'date',
- 'dry-run' => false,
+ 'cmd' => 'date',
+ 'dry-run' => false,
}
- }
+ end
let(:output) { 'Success' }
-
+
before do
allow_any_instance_of(Yacli::Run).to receive(:pass_cli).and_return(nil)
end
-
- after do
- #
- end
-
- before(:each) do
- #Helpers::pre_run_helper
- end
-
- after(:each) do
- # Nothing
- end
-
- it "print date" do
- cmd = "date"
+
+ it 'print date' do
+ cmd = 'date'
allow_any_instance_of(Yacli::Run).to receive(:pass_cli).with(cmd).and_return(output)
run = Yacli::Run.new(opt)
expect(run.go(cmd)).to eq output
end
-
end
end